Vegan Evaporated Milk Recipe

  • Total Time: 40 minutes
  • Yield: 1 3/4 cups 1x
  • Diet: Vegan

Ingredients

  • 3½ cups non-dairy milk


Instructions

  1. In a saucepan over medium heat, add the non-dairy milk and bring to a simmer.
  2. Let the milk simmer for 30-40 minutes, or until the volume reduces by about half, stirring occasionally.
  3. Once the milk has been reduced by half, strain the mixture. Set the milk in the fridge to cool.

Notes

  • Storage: This dairy-free evaporated milk recipe will keep in an airtight glass jar, such as a mason jar, in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.
  • Use a higher-fat plant-based milk: Traditional evaporated milk is typically made from whole milk and is naturally high in fat. For a similar fat content and richness, we recommend using higher-fat milk, such as coconut or cashew milk.
  • Do not use homemade oat milk: Store-bought oat milk is made with added stabilizers and emulsifiers that prevent it from becoming slimy when heated. Heating homemade oat milk will release the starches in the oats and yield a slimy, unpleasant texture.
